Ways to Spot a Quality Painting Contractor

I have actually been a painting contractor for 26 years and because time I have heard more than one unique reason why customer pick a more affordable painter. On the other hand, I have likewise had lots of calls from regretful homeowners who realize they made a big mistake. Numerous wish they had simply paid more for quality professionals. Still others are sorry they did not have a look at a contractor prior to deciding to hire them.

Exactly what I have noticed in my years as a painting contractor is that numerous house owners simply do not know how to examine the abilities of painting professionals. Most will look for the most inexpensive quote not realizing that they will probably not get their cash's worth. The truth is an inexpensive contractor can often cost you more cash in the long run.

Labor and materials are at such a high price that the painting contractor's profits are already slim. For that reason, a low-cost contractor is offering slashed prices for a factor. That reason is usually poor service or worth.

Use the following 10 conditions to have a look at Marietta contractors prior to you hire them.

Too lots of painting contractors will blow into town and do inferior work for a couple of years, then they start to feel the wrath of homeowner who is not pleased with their work and they pack it up and move to the next city. If the contractor you are considering has, at least 10 years in your location this is an excellent indicator of stability, not to discuss quality.
How are the painters on your contractors crew paid? I originally paid my team by the hour when I began my painting business in 1982. For about 7 years, I was less than delighted with performance so I chose to alter to a portion based pay system. Quality of the painters work went up substantially and the jobs were getting completer in half the time. Instantly my painters had a much better frame of mind once they knew they would be paid on portion. Their interests were now directly tied to the quality and timeliness of the job. Outstanding performance caused less double checking at the end of a project and a much better bottom line for everyone included.

Check the contractor's prior task referrals. Bear in mind though that people each have opinions on what quality is and you must not base your choice on references alone.
Keep an eye out for the aggressive painting professionals who are volume oriented. Their whole goal is to turn out as numerous ended up houses as possible in a short amount of time to make quick loan. The quality of their work will not be driven by any kind of core values. You and your house will suffer at the hands of this kind of contractor.
Make certain that your contractor is completely clear on there being a walk through with the head crew member and yourself to look for areas that require cleaned up or fixed. This need to take place before you compose any look for the task. This protects both you and the contractor from issues later. This walk through insures that you more than happy with the work and assists to eliminate or reduce guarantee concerns for the painting contractor, conserving the company both time and money. This is the best approach for concluding a job and skilled specialists who are worried about customer service are aware of this.
